Availability: In stock. Price: $24.95 172 pg, paper, ’08 This is a practical problem-focused self-help manual from the UK is for men with eating disorders and body image problems. Increasingly, boys and men are suffering with eating disorders and related body image problems. Some have full-blown conditions such as anorexia nervosa, bulimia, binge eating, compulsive exercising, or bigorexia. Others are distressed by slightly lesser degrees of disordered eating or over-exercise. This book addresses them all. Divided into four sections, this evidence based survival kit covers: * the wider cultural context of male body image problems CONTENTS Part I Fat is more than a feminist issue Part II Do you have a body image disorder? Part III Science fiction and science fact Part IV Seven stages to recovery ABOUT THE AUTHOR: John F. Morgan is head of the Yorkshire Centre for Eating Disorders. His research portfolio addresses causes and treatments of eating disorders, and he was written commentaries on eating and body image disorders in men for various journals and media.
